Meet Coco 💜
Meet Coco, who came into care with her sister Honey after they were found alone and cold by a member of the public, weighing just 165 grams.
She has been lovingly bottle-fed, and while she may be a little shy at first, it doesn't take long for her beautiful personality to shine through.
Like her sister, Coco absolutely ADORES her crochet toy carrot—so much so that one will be going home with her to her new family!
She loves playing with her ball towers, climbing to the very top of the cat tree, and exploring everything around her. Coco is also a superstar with her litter tray. As long as she's shown where it is in her new home, she'll continue to use it like the clever little girl she is.
Coco has been raised around her foster family's cats and loves playing chasing games with them. She has also met dogs and doesn't show much interest in them.
Although she hasn't lived with young children, we're confident that with gentle introductions and respectful handling, she'll make a wonderful little companion.
At bedtime, Coco's favourite place is curled up on top of you, and don't be surprised if you're woken during the night by her incredibly LOUD PURRRRRR! ❤️

Adoption details
If you would like to express interest in adopting, we ask that you send through some info about yourself, your family and home, if you rent or own (rental agreement required if renting and rates notice required if you own) and what you can offer this gorgeous baby. Our aim is to find the best homes for our babies, not necessarily first in best dressed, so a good detailed application will make you stand out from the rest.
Once we have received your email outlining the above, those who we feel may be suitable, will be sent an Adoption Questionnaire to complete. Your enquiry will then be passed onto the appropriate carer and successful applicants will be contacted via phone.
